Factors to consider when choosing a Nautilus Plan

  1. What industry you belong to — in other words, what do you do? Are you a smaller firm that needs a calling feature for your receptionists? Are you a contact center looking to adopt a remote work setup for your agents? Are you a current contact center handling multiple channels at the same time?
  2. The size of your team — how many agents do you currently have and how often will they be on the phones? This is an important measure, primarily because determining these numbers will allow you to see which features you’ll end up using. This greatly mitigates unwanted costs. Speaking of costs, we have the last (and arguably most important) factor
  3. Your budget — how much are you willing to spend? This could spell the difference between success and failure for your business. We believe that the most attractive feature of a scalable business communication plan is its possibility for cost-effectivity and savings. The more features you go for, the more money you’ll end up shelling out.
